2, HID compared with the general housing halogen glass, light-emitting mode, color temperature (K value), brightness (lumens L value), consumption of electricity and life.
Glass housing: the use of quartz glass halogen, HID use of anti-ultraviolet UV-cut crystal glass.
Luminescence way: the Use of Incendiary tungsten halogen light began to open as long as oxidation, HID caused by the use of gas molecules bump into each other to split the luminescence.
Color Temperature (K value): halogen yellow, color temperature value of 3000K, HID lights were white, color temperature value of 4300K (Note: The test is the sun at noon, the temperature value of about 5250K or so)
Brightness (L value): halogen for the 1000L, HID lights for the 3300L, to increase brightness by 200%. Power consumption: Halogen 55W, current 5.5A, HID lamps 35W, current 3.5A, saving half of it. Life: 320 hours halogen, HID lamps 2500 hours, the service life of halogen 10 times, and almost car life. |
